英文摘要
My research group uses both entangled photons and ultracold atoms to study novel quantum phenomena, specifically in relation to the challenges and questions raised by the exciting new applications in quantum information science, and to studying foundational issues in quantum mechanics. Over the past 15 years, experimental capabilities for control of quantum systems have reached a level that makes it reasonable to expect widespread applications, ranging from quantum information processing to coherent control of reactions to quantum simulations of previously intractable systems. In particular, it is now well understood that quantum information is qualitatively different from its classical cousin, and a large international effort aims at building the systems which will allow us to take advantage of the exponential power of quantum information processing. Over the next five years, we propose principally to (1) develop advanced techniques for generating novel multi-photon entangled states, and investigate their properties and applications; (2) use our optical lattice experiment to further study quantum control and measurement techniques in the context of the long-term problem of controlling quantum devices; (3) use our newly-developed atom-ready source of quantum light in conjunction with our ultracold atoms to study new paradigms in quantum light-matter interactions; (4) use the interactions of our Bose-Einstein condensate with time-dependent potentials to address long-standing questions over tunneling times and other fundamental issues in quantum mechanics; and (5) continue our optical studies of different paradigms of applied quantum measurement. Goal (3) is a particularly timely quest, as recent proposals make it look like optical nonlinearities at the quantum level may be within reach, and have also shown how they could be used to build a quantum computer. Having developed a system for producing some of the coldest atoms in the universe, along with the highest-spectral-brightness source of entangled photons in the world, we are in an excellent position to take on this exciting challenge.
